Resolution: ASUS A7V-E SE + Linux Kernel 2.6.15.1 + SATA

The problem -- 30 seconds for each disk IO operation, followed by
syslog messages such as:

ata1: slow completion (cmd ef)
ata2: slow completion (cmd ef)
ata1: command 0x25 timeout, stat 0x50 host_stat 24
ata2: command 0x25 timeout, stat 0x50 host_stat 24

The cause -- the ASUS A7V-E with the sata_via driver does not
receive interupts without ACPI enabled (yet another Via IRQ quirk,
or incomplete handing or the currently known quirks?). Once ACPI
is enabled, the SATA works perfectly, on both a A7V-E SE and a
A7V-E Deluxe.

These VT8237R based boards use a VT6420 Serial ATA chip
(attention http://linuxmafia.com/faq/Hardware/sata.html maintainer!).

The next problems seem to be 64-bit regions being used for the
ethernet (SKGE) and Nvida 7800GTX on a 32-bit kernel causing
the drivers for these devices to refuse to load.
